We are looking for a motivated and enthusiastic Azure Engineer to join our Research & Development (R&D) team at Kinetic. As our hosting strategy for customer systems has evolved from on-premise to cloud-based services, we aim to provide consistent, robust, and efficient delivery. With around 60 hosted customers and more migrating every year, this role offers a great opportunity to grow your skills in cloud computing and be part of an exciting transition.
The ideal candidate will have a solid foundation in cloud computing technologies, with a focus on Microsoft Azure. You will be eager to learn, proactive in problem-solving, and ready to contribute to the continuous improvement of our cloud offering.
Key Responsibilities
Assist in the development and maintenance of our Azure platform, helping to increase engineering capacity within the team and improve platform availability.
Support the implementation of best practices for Azure and help to increase organizational knowledge around cloud technologies.
Contribute to improving the efficiency of the customer onboarding process.
Help maintain and utilize Azure data output to support decision-making and strategy development.
Skills, Knowledge & Expertise
Basic understanding of cloud security and compliance requirements, such as ISO27001 or PCI-DSS.
Interest in learning about automated CI/CD pipelines.
Familiarity with any programming language (e.g., Python, Go, C#, JavaScript) is a bonus.
Exposure to other cloud platforms such as AWS or GCP is advantageous.
Experience or interest in virtual desktop/app products like Azure Virtual Desktop or Citrix.

About Kinetic
Kinetic was founded in 1998 with one aim: to develop the most innovative software to help university accommodation and conferencing teams deliver the best student and customer experiences possible.
Fast forward 25 years, and we are now the technology partner of choice to the worlds' leading universities and colleges. We are ranked #1 on the APUC framework, ITS1051 AP, for student accommodation management, conferencing and events management, hotel management and multifunctional management systems.
We supply mission-critical software for over 350 customers, from Stanford University to Monash in Australia... Not to mention over 80% of universities in the UK.
Since 2015, Kinetic has been part of the Volaris Group. Volaris help strengthen and grow vertical market software companies so, like Kinetic, they become leaders in their industry.
